Made by Carlo Quaglia for the folk at Jerry Thomas Speakeasy, Vermouth del Professore is made to an old Piedmont recipe with white wine, pure cane sugar, and herbs and spices including mountain mint, wormwood, gentian, cloves and mace.

Review and Tasting


Sampled on 13/07/2023

Appearance:

Clear, golden amber.

Aroma:

Wormwood, clove, vanilla, orange and mace with floral and herbal complexity.

Taste:

Bittersweet. Zesty orange, vanilla, cinnamon and black pepper spice with bitter gentian and quinine.

Aftertaste:

Bitter gentian and quinine with vanilla, cinnamon and delicate white pepper spice.

Overall:

Bittersweet with quinine, gentian and wormwood all contributing bitterness. Much bigger and spicier than your average "dry" vermouth with zesty orange, vanilla and enlivening cinnamon and white pepper.
